This jig is designed to use a disc grinder safely.
There is no need to hold down the material by hand, and the handle is ergonomic and easy to use.
The slide moves about 250mm. Wide materials can now be cut with high accuracy.
Epoxy resin and aluminum are used for the linear bush housing.
In addition, a thrust bearing is used for the rotating part, achieving high accuracy and smooth rotation.
The linear bush has a dustproof felt bush attached.
Thrust bearings have a structure that prevents dust from entering.
Thrust bearings are inexpensive and cost less than 600 yen. You can make it cheaper than it looks.
